Abstract

PURPOSE: To provide the subject apparatus enabling satisfactory binding of straw by switching the destination of waste straw between a cutter part and a knotter part and transferring the straw to the knotter part according to the length of the straw. CONSTITUTION: The destination of a threshed waste straw is made to be switchable between a cutter part 3 and a knotter part 4 placed at the back of a threshing part and the straw is supplied to the destination through a waste straw transfer member 2 having an extensible clamping rail. The clamping rail is switchable between a long-straw binding position and a short-straw binding position when an opening member 31 placed at the inlet part of the cutter part 3 is opened and the clamping rail is switched from the contracted cutting posture to the extended binding posture attained by closing the opening member 31.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a threshing machine culm transporting device, in which threshed culm wastes are switchably supplied to a cutter section and a knotter section provided at the rear of the threshing machine, and in particular, When switching from the cutter to the knotter,
The present invention relates to a culm conveyor device for a threshing machine that can always supply the stems so that the stems can be bound regardless of long culms and short culms.

2. Description of the Related Art Conventionally, a cutter section and a knotter section, which are attached to the rear of a thresher mounted on a harvester such as a combine,
An culvert carrier with adjustable holding rails is installed obliquely from the feed chain side to the rear side of the machine rear side, and threshed culms are switchably supplied to the cutter part and knotter part. The transport device, in a state in which the opening / closing member provided at the entrance of the cutter section is opened, contracts the holding rail opposite to the culvert transporting body to supply and cut the culvert to the cutter section, and In the state in which the opening / closing member is closed, the holding rail is extended and supplied to the knotter portion for binding.

However, in the conventional culm transporting apparatus, especially in the binding posture for binding the culms,
Since the holding rail is set to bind the stem side of the standard length of culm, in the case of long culm, the ear side is bound and the plant side is disturbed, and in the case of short culm, The root side of the plant was bound, which resulted in problems such as insufficient drying of the culm after the burn. The present invention has been made in view of the above circumstances to eliminate the conventional problems, and its intended purpose is to supply the culms to the knotter, regardless of the long culm and the short culm. , It is an object of the present invention to provide a culm conveying device for a thresher that can always supply the stems so that they can be properly bound, and thus can easily perform processing such as drying of the culms after binding. is there.

Therefore, according to the present invention, since the movable rail is at the most extended position at the long culm binding position of the operating lever, the culms can be deeply supplied to the knot side of the knotter to bind the stems thereof. it can. Also, if the operating lever is operated to the short culm bundling position, the culms can be supplied shallowly and the stalks of the short culm can be accurately bound, and by operating the operating lever to the cutting position, the opening / closing member (cutter) can be cut. The movable rail can be contracted while the lid) is opened, and the culms can be supplied to the cutter section for accurate cutting.
